The KingSpec NX-512 2280 is a 512GB internal SSD built on the M.2 2280 form factor. It connects through a PCI-Express 3.0 x4 interface using the NVMe 1.3 protocol and uses 3D NAND flash memory. Sequential reads reach up to 3400 MBps and writes up to 2500 MBps.
This drive suits desktop and laptop users who need a straightforward NVMe upgrade for faster boot times and application loading. It works in any system with an M.2 2280 slot that supports PCIe 3.0 x4. Buyers who require a built-in heatsink or higher endurance than 480TB total bytes written should consider other models.
The PCIe 3.0 x4 interface paired with NVMe 1.3 determines whether this SSD will operate at its rated 3400 MBps read and 2500 MBps write speeds. A slot limited to PCIe 2.0 or SATA will not deliver these figures.
